Location
Le Grand Mazarin sits in the heart of Le Marais, surrounded by independent art galleries and boutique shops. This district offers easy access to famous landmarks and is close to the Seine, ensuring a rich cultural experience. The hotel is accessible via multiple public transport options, including Hôtel de Ville and Châtelet les Halles.
Rooms
The hotel features 50 rooms and 11 suites, each designed by Martin Brudnizki, showcasing a fusion of French classicism and artistic exploration. Rooms offer views of the Seine and the historic skyline, providing a serene escape from the lively surroundings. Connecting rooms are available, accommodating families of up to 10 guests comfortably.
Dining
Boubalé, the hotel's signature restaurant, offers Mediterranean cuisine with influences from the Levant, bringing seasonal freshness to each dish. The bar and cabaret present signature cocktails and a creative ambiance for memorable evenings. Boubalé serves brunch every Sunday, featuring a menu that highlights gastronomic innovation and flavor exploration.
Wellness
The wellness area houses an 8-meter swimming pool, embellished by a ceiling fresco by Jacques Merle, creating a tranquil environment for relaxation. Guests can also enjoy a fitness room equipped with Technogym(R) equipment and personalized treatments in the private treatment room. A hammam and jacuzzi complement the wellness experience, promoting rejuvenation after exploring Paris.
Entertainment
Le Petit Bazar, located in the hotel's basement, transforms into a speakeasy on weekends, featuring DJ sets in an intimate setting until 2 a.m. The bar offers a cocktail menu inspired by One Thousand and One Nights, inviting guests to experience unique flavors in a cozy atmosphere. This dynamic entertainment setting makes Le Grand Mazarin a distinctive choice for nightlife.
